California Governor Says Theater Reopening Still Months Away

By Gene Maddaus Senior Media Writer Theaters are still months away from reopening in California, according to a plan laid out on Tuesday by Gov.

Gavin Newsom. In his daily briefing, Newsom outlined a four-stage plan to reopen the economy. He did not offer a specific timetable, but the plan calls for theaters to reopen in “Stage 3,” which Newsom said would be “months, not weeks” away. “Stage 3” also entails the reopening of hair salons, nail salons, gyms, and churches, though with modified practices to help slow the spread of the coronavirus.

Sporting events could also resume, although without spectators. The statewide “Stay at Home” order would be lifted in Stage 4, allowing for the resumption of concerts, conventions and sporting events
